The paper presents and discusses the results of atmospheric air quality research conducted in 2012 with reference to the level of BTEX compounds in the Tri-City agglomeration-Gdansk, Gdynia, and Sopot (northern Poland). At the stage of BTEX sampling from the ambient air, RadielloA (R) diffusive passive samplers were applied. The annual time-weighted average concentrations for benzene, toluene, ethylbenzene, and xylenes (BTEX) in the Tri-City agglomeration were as follows: Gdansk-0.75 A +/- 0.67 mu g/m(3), 1.08 A +/- 0.43 mu g/m(3), 0.30 A +/- 0.12 mu g/m(3), 1.34 A +/- 0.52 mu g/m(3); Gdynia-0.66 A +/- 0.51 mu g/m(3), 0.88 A +/- 0.40 mu g/m(3), 0.24 A +/- 0.12 mu g/m(3), 1.15 A +/- 0.53 mu g/m(3); Sopot-0.63 A +/- 0.55 mu g/m(3), 0.84 A +/- 0.37 mu g/m(3), 0.13 A +/- 0.05 mu g/m(3), 0.67 A +/- 0.23 mu g/m(3). The values of the B:T:E:X inter-species concentration ratio and the toluene/benzene, (m, p)-xylene/benzene, o-xylene/benzene, (m, p)-xylene/ethylbenzene concentration ratio were also determined. Based on the results obtained, one can conclude that the main sources of emissions into the atmospheric air, regarding BTEX compounds in the Tri-City agglomeration, especially the Gdansk and Gdynia areas are motor vehicles powered by internal combustion engines and domestic heating systems characterized by low efficiency.
